Key Insights

The Asia-Pacific Feed Pigments Market is poised for significant growth, with an expected market size of $200 million by 2025, projected to expand at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 2.20% from 2025 to 2033. Key drivers of this market include the increasing demand for enhanced animal nutrition and the rising awareness of feed quality among livestock producers. Within the Asia-Pacific region, countries such as China, Japan, and India are leading the market due to their large livestock industries and growing focus on animal health. The market is segmented by type into Carotenoids, Curcumin, Caramel, Spirulina, and others, with Carotenoids holding a significant share owing to their widespread use in enhancing the color of poultry and aquaculture products. Animal type segments include Ruminant, Poultry, Swine, Aquaculture, and others, with Poultry being the largest segment due to the high consumption of poultry products across the region.

Major trends shaping the market include the shift towards natural feed additives and the integration of advanced technologies in feed production. However, the market faces restraints such as stringent regulations on feed additives and the high cost of natural pigments. Leading companies in the Asia-Pacific Feed Pigments Market include Kalsec Inc, Behn Meyer Group, Novus International Inc, BASF SE, Synthite Industries Ltd, Nutrex NV, Kemin Industries Ltd, and DSM Animal Nutrition and Health. These companies are focusing on research and development to introduce innovative products that meet the evolving needs of the livestock industry. The market's growth trajectory is expected to be supported by continuous innovation and strategic collaborations among key players, aiming to capitalize on the growing demand for high-quality feed pigments in the Asia-Pacific region.

Dominant Markets & Segments in Asia-Pacific Feed Pigments Market

The Asia-Pacific Feed Pigments Market is dominated by certain regions, countries, and segments, each driven by unique factors.

  • China: As the largest market in the Asia-Pacific region, China's dominance is driven by its massive livestock industry and increasing consumer demand for quality animal products. Economic policies promoting agricultural development and infrastructure improvements in rural areas are key drivers.
  • India: Rapid growth in the poultry and aquaculture sectors, coupled with government initiatives to boost animal husbandry, positions India as a significant market. The focus on sustainable farming practices and the rising middle class's demand for nutritious food are pivotal.
  • Carotenoids Segment: This segment leads the market due to its wide application across various animal types, particularly poultry and aquaculture. The health benefits associated with carotenoids, such as improved immune function and coloration, are major factors.
  • Poultry Segment: The poultry segment is the largest consumer of feed pigments in the Asia-Pacific region, driven by the increasing demand for poultry meat and eggs. The need for pigments to enhance the visual appeal and nutritional value of poultry products is a significant driver.

Detailed analysis of these dominant segments reveals that:

  • China's dominance in the Asia-Pacific Feed Pigments Market is not only due to its large market size but also its strategic investments in technology and sustainable farming practices. The government's push towards modernizing agriculture has led to increased adoption of advanced feed additives, including pigments.
  • India's growth is propelled by a combination of rising domestic demand and export potential. The country's focus on self-sufficiency in food production and the expansion of its aquaculture industry are key factors. The use of pigments in fish and shrimp farming to enhance product quality and marketability is a notable trend.
  • The Carotenoids segment is experiencing rapid growth due to its versatility and the health benefits it offers. Carotenoids are used in a variety of feed applications, from poultry to aquaculture, making them a preferred choice among producers. The segment's growth is also supported by the trend towards natural and organic feed additives.
  • The Poultry segment is the largest consumer of feed pigments due to the global demand for poultry products. The segment's growth is driven by the need to meet consumer expectations for high-quality, visually appealing products. The use of pigments to enhance the color of egg yolks and chicken skin is a significant factor.

Asia-Pacific Feed Pigments Market Product Innovations

Product innovations in the Asia-Pacific Feed Pigments Market are centered around enhancing efficiency and sustainability. Recent developments include the introduction of microencapsulated pigments, which improve stability and bioavailability. Companies like BASF SE are leveraging biotechnology to produce pigments with enhanced nutritional profiles, aligning with the market's shift towards natural and health-focused feed additives. These innovations are well-suited to meet the growing demand for high-quality animal products and are expected to drive market growth.
